CYLINDER COLOR BANDS.-Cylinder color bands appear upon the cylinder body and serve as color warnings when they are yellow, brown, blue, green, or gray. The bands also provide color combinations to separate and distinguish cylinders for convenience in handling, storage, and shipping.

Nomenclature In the United States, "bottled gas" typically refers to liquefied petroleum gas. "Bottled gas" is sometimes used in medical supply, especially for portable oxygen tanks. Packaged industrial gases are frequently called "cylinder gas", though "bottled gas" is sometimes used. The term propane tank is also used for cylinders with propane.

The colour coding is applied to the shoulder or the curved portion of the cylinder and it identifies the property of the gas inside the cylinder. Yellow - toxic. Red - flammable. Light blue - oxidising. Bright Green - inert. A gas cylinder having two concentric colour bands indicates a combination of properties.

Identifying Cylinders Coordinating colours so you know what's in the cylinder. While the cylinder label is the primary means of identifying the properties of the gas in a cylinder, the colour coding of the cylinder itself provides a further guide.
